How Much Does an Infrastructure Security Analyst Make in Iowa?

Updated March 26, 2024
Filter

Individually reported data submitted by users of our website

Normal Confidence
$129,286/yr
Average Base Pay
Low $114,118
Average $129,286
High $142,999
The average salary for Infrastructure Security Analyst is $129,286 per year in Iowa.

Top 10 Highest Paying Cities For Infrastructure Security Analyst Jobs in Iowa

It is important to understand how location impacts your career prospects in the United States. There are some cities where an Infrastructure Security Analyst can find a job easily with a greater salary paid then achieve a higher standard of living. Below is the top cities list for Infrastructure Security Analyst job salaries in Iowa. Some cities can pay higher salaries for Infrastructure Security Analyst jobs, which can indicate that there is a large demand for Infrastructure Security Analyst positions in this city.
The following table shows top 10 cities where the Infrastructure Security Analyst salary is higher than other cities in Iowa. Des Moines takes first place in this list, followed by Ankeny, Urbandale. The Infrastructure Security Analyst salary is $131,042 in Des Moines, which is lower than the national average. There is 0 city's Infrastructure Security Analyst salary higher than national average in Iowa.
The average salary for an Infrastructure Security Analyst in Iowa is $129,286, but we found that the city with the highest salary for Infrastructure Security Analyst jobs is Des Moines, IA, and it is higher than Ankeny. Infrastructure Security Analyst jobs in Des Moines can have the opportunity to earn higher salaries than in other cities in Iowa.
CITY ANNUAL SALARY MONTHLY PAY WEEKLY PAY HOURLY WAGE
Des Moines $131,042 $10,920 $2,520 $63
Ankeny $131,042 $10,920 $2,520 $63
Urbandale $131,042 $10,920 $2,520 $63
Ames $129,826 $10,819 $2,497 $62
Cedar Rapids $129,286 $10,774 $2,486 $62
Council Bluffs $128,475 $10,706 $2,471 $62
Davenport $128,205 $10,684 $2,465 $62
Iowa City $128,205 $10,684 $2,465 $62
Dubuque $127,530 $10,627 $2,452 $61
Waterloo $125,503 $10,459 $2,414 $60

Frequently Asked Questions About an Infrastructure Security Analyst Salaries

What is the average of an Infrastructure Security Analyst in Iowa?

The Infrastructure Security Analyst salary range is from $114,118 to $142,999, and the average Infrastructure Security Analyst salary is $129,286/year in Iowa. The Infrastructure Security Analyst's salary will change in different locations.

Which location pays the highest Infrastructure Security Analyst salary in the United States?

The Infrastructure Security Analyst salary in San Jose, CA is $169,544 which is the highest in the US.

What kinds of reasons will influence the Infrastructure Security Analyst's salary?

Besides the location, employees' education degree, related skills, and work experience also will influence the salary. Try to improve your skills and experience to get a higher salary for the position of Infrastructure Security Analyst.
